There have been efforts at reducing the paternalism of mission by using the term 
'partnership'. I agree with Rheenan that this has simply "... frequently become 
a disguised form of paternalism."[231] Helander and Niwagila concede in Tanzania 
that "fixation in the roles of 'rich giver' and 'poor receiver' has taken 
place"[232] and that "there cannot be a partnership in a setting up of 
dependency and patronage"[233] acknowledging that "the sharing of material 
resources is perhaps one of the most difficult matters in the history of 
partnership."[234]
